CIBC

Bank
3.2
Based on 2 reviews

Reviews

Pe
PetRide Halifax P
169 month ago
Has a drive thru ATM.
Pe
PetRide Halifax P
169 month ago
Really should fix their alarm. It goes off about once a week and it's really annoying when you live next door.